Automotive locks deal with a range of concerns, and determining these can assist you comprehend if repair work are necessary. Here are some typical issues car owners might come across:
Key Won't Turn: Sometimes, the key will not kip down the lock due to dirt, damaged elements, or other blockages.Lock Jams: A lock may jam due to internal wear or debris obstructing the mechanism.Remote Key Fob Not Working: The battery in an essential fob might pass away, or there could be electronic problems preventing it from functioning.Locks Not Engaging: In central locking systems, a lock might stop working to engage when the button is pressed, indicating an electrical or mechanical fault.Key Sticking: If a crucial sticks in the lock, it may suggest internal wear or corrosion.The Importance of Automotive Lock Repair

If a vehicle owner chooses to pursue automotive lock repair work, understanding the general process will assist streamline the experience. Here's a step-by-step guide to the repair work procedure:
Assessment: Identify the particular concern with the lock. Is it mechanical, electrical, or electronic in nature?Disassembly: For mechanical locks, take apart the lock assembly thoroughly. For electronic locks, make sure the automobile's battery is detached before working on the system.Inspection: Examine individual elements for wear and tear. Check springs, pins, tumblers, circuits, and other appropriate parts.Repair or Replace: Depending on the assessment, either fix the harmed element(s) or change them totally.Reassembly: Carefully reassemble the lock, making sure all components are positioned properly.Testing: Before concluding, test the lock completely to guarantee it runs efficiently and safely.Often Asked Questions (FAQ)1. 3. How can I avoid lock concerns?
Routine maintenance, such as lubricating locks, keeping essential fobs updated, and preventing requiring keys can assist prevent lock problems.
4. The length of time does a lock repair take?
The time for a lock repair can depend upon the complexity of the problem. A simple mechanical lock repair work may take about an hour, while electronic systems might take longer, depending on the problem.
